Bloomberg Intelligence hosted by Paul Sweeney and John Tucker
- Woo Jin Ho, Bloomberg Intelligence Senior Hardware and Networking Analyst, discusses Super Micro Computer saying it plans $7 billion in equity and equity-linked financing transactions to fund component purchases to satisfy around $39 billion in AI server orders it has received from customers.
- Caroline Hyde, BTech Co Anchor, discusses SpaceX’s IPO. Gulf wealth funds have put in orders for shares worth several billions of dollars in SpaceX’s initial public offering. Saudi Arabia’s Public Investment Fund and Kuwait Investment Authority have each placed orders for shares worth $1 billion to $5 billion.
-Steve Man, Bloomberg Intelligence Global Autos and Industrials Research Analyst, discusses his research on Tesla and SpaceX. According to Bloomberg Intelligence: A Tesla-SpaceX merger looks far from assured in the medium term, widespread market speculation aside, as benefits from Terafab chip work, the Macrohard software development project and any Tesla role in space exploration are years away.
-Diana Rosero Pena, Bloomberg Intelligence Consumer Staples Analyst, discusses Chewy's earnings. Chewy shares drop after management gave additional guidance metrics on the conference call including cautious comments on customer additions, and profit measures. The company stated that it is seeing a “modest level of incremental pressure on premiumization and product attach rates” from its current customer base.
